What is the benefit of Dependency Injection in C sharp?
Dependency Injection helps to reduce the tight coupling among software components. Dependency Injection reduces the hard-coded dependencies among your classes by injecting those dependencies at run time instead of design time technically.
What is Dependency Injection in C?
Dependency Injection (DI) is a software design pattern that allows us to develop loosely coupled code. The Dependency Injection pattern uses a builder object to initialize objects and provide the required dependencies to the object means it allows you to “inject” a dependency from outside the class.
How many dependencies are too many?
The fact your class has so many dependencies indicates there are more than one responsibilities within the class. Often there is an implicit domain concept waiting to be made explicit by identifying it and making it into its own service. Generally speaking, most classes should never need more than 4-5 dependencies.

How is dependency injection used to implement IOC?
Dependency Injection (DI) is a design pattern used to implement IoC. It allows the creation of dependent objects outside of a class and provides those objects to a class through different ways.

How does Dependency Injection work in ASPnet core?
There are three service lifetimes in ASP.NET Core Dependency Injection: Transient services are created every time they are injected or requested. Scoped services are created per scope. In a web application, every web request creates a new separated service scope.
